Ajouter une classe d'entités à la topologie (Gestion des données)

Niveau de licence :BasicStandardAdvanced

Récapitulatif

Ajoute une classe d'entités à une topologie.

Utilisation

Syntaxe

AddFeatureClassToTopology_management (in_topology, in_featureclass, xy_rank, z_rank)
ParamètreExplicationType de données
in_topology

Topologie à laquelle la classe d'entités sera associée.

Topology Layer
in_featureclass

Classe d'entités à ajouter à la topologie. La classe d'entités doit se trouver dans le même jeu de données d'entité que la topologie.

Feature Layer
xy_rank

Degré relatif de précision de localisation associé aux sommets des entités de la classe d'entités par rapport à ceux des autres classes d'entités associées à la topologie. La classe d'entités avec la plus haute précision doit avoir un classement élevé (nombre inférieur, par exemple 1) qu'une classe d'entités qui est connue pour être moins précise.

Long
z_rank

Les classes d'entités gérant les valeurs Z ont des valeurs d'altitude intégrées à leur géométrie pour chaque sommet. En définissant un classement z, vous pouvez influer sur la manière dont les sommets possédant des valeurs z précises sont capturés ou groupés avec des sommets dont les mesures z sont moins précises.

Long

Exemple de code

Exemple de script autonome de l'outil AddFeatureClassToTopology

Le script autonome suivant illustre l'utilisation de la fonction AddFeatureClassToTopology.

# Name: AddFeatureClassToTopology_Example.py
# Description: Adds a feature class to participate in a topology


# Import system modules

import arcpy
arcpy.AddFeatureClassToTopology_management(r"D:\Calgary\Trans.mdb\Streets\Street_Topo",r"D:\Calgary\Trans.mdb\Streets\StreetNetwork", 1, 0.1)

Environnements

Thèmes connexes

Informations de licence

ArcGIS for Desktop Basic: Annuler
ArcGIS for Desktop Standard: Oui
ArcGIS for Desktop Advanced: Oui
6/5/2014